Ágios Athanásios is a village located in the Limassol District of Cyprus. While there may not be extensive information available specifically on Ágios Athanásios, here are some general pros of traveling to Cyprus and the Limassol District:
Rich History: Cyprus has a long and fascinating history, with influences from various civilizations such as Greek, Roman, Byzantine, and Ottoman. Visitors can explore ancient ruins, historical sites, and museums to learn about the island's past.
Beautiful Beaches: Cyprus is known for its stunning beaches with crystal-clear waters and golden sands. The Limassol District, where Ágios Athanásios is located, offers several beaches where you can relax, swim, and enjoy water sports.
Charming Villages: Cyprus is home to many picturesque villages with traditional architecture, cobblestone streets, and friendly locals. Exploring villages like Ágios Athanásios can provide a glimpse into the local way of life and offer a peaceful retreat from the bustling cities.
Delicious Cuisine: Cypriot cuisine is a delightful blend of Mediterranean flavors, influenced by Greek, Turkish, and Middle Eastern culinary traditions. Visitors can enjoy fresh seafood, grilled meats, meze (small dishes), and local wines while dining in traditional tavernas.
Outdoor Activities: The island's diverse landscape offers opportunities for outdoor activities such as hiking, biking, and exploring nature reserves. The Troodos Mountains, located near Limassol, provide hiking trails with scenic views and the chance to discover traditional mountain villages.
Warm Hospitality: Cypriots are known for their warm hospitality and friendliness towards visitors. Travelers to Ágios Athanásios and other parts of Cyprus can expect a welcoming atmosphere and helpful locals.
Overall, traveling to Ágios Athanásios and the Limassol District can offer a mix of history, culture, natural beauty, and relaxation, making it a compelling destination for those seeking a Mediterranean getaway.
Ágios Athanásios is a beautiful village located in the Lemesós district of Cyprus, known for its picturesque surroundings and traditional architecture. While there are many advantages to visiting Ágios Athanásios, there are also some potential drawbacks or cons that travelers should be aware of:
Limited public transportation: Ágios Athanásios is a small village, and public transportation options may be limited. Travelers may find it challenging to get around the village and explore nearby areas without a car.
Limited amenities: As a small village, Ágios Athanásios may have limited amenities such as restaurants, shops, and entertainment options. Travelers looking for a bustling nightlife or a wide variety of dining options may be disappointed.
Language barrier: While English is widely spoken in Cyprus, travelers may encounter some language barriers in smaller villages like Ágios Athanásios. It's always helpful to have some basic knowledge of Greek or carry a translation app to facilitate communication.
Seasonal variations: Depending on the time of year you visit Ágios Athanásios, you may encounter extreme weather conditions such as high temperatures in the summer or cooler temperatures in the winter. It's important to plan your trip accordingly and pack appropriate clothing.
Tourist crowds: While Ágios Athanásios is not as popular as other tourist destinations in Cyprus, it may still attract some tourists during peak seasons. Travelers looking for a more off-the-beaten-path experience may find the presence of other tourists to be a drawback.
Overall, while Ágios Athanásios offers a charming and authentic Cypriot experience, travelers should be prepared for some potential challenges such as limited amenities and transportation options.
